China Airlines: the government would sell down its stake in the carrier to under 50%

Taiwan, Republic of China - But it would remain the largest shareholder

The Minister of Transportation of Taiwan, Lin Lin-san, said lately that the local government decided to sell a great part of its stake in China Airlines: though it would retain management control in the biggest airline of the island.
